Pay us, we'll help you get a bid
After presenting several recruitment workshops at the Birmingham, Alabama Saks last year, these ladies have formed a business to sell their "rush" advice: http://www.rushbiddies.com/
I think part of this has come about because Birmingham, despite its size and the huge recruitments at the U of Alabama and Auburn U, and having at least four in-town or close-to-town colleges with NPC sororities, has not had an alumnae panhellenic. One is being formed now.
Surely they are not the only people who've come up with an idea for selling their advice. Do you know of similar businesses with a local slant? Please post their websites! I'd love to take a look.
Wonder what happens when a candidate is rejected by every group? Do they give a refund?
